What is a dental vacation — and why Cuenca is ideal
A dental vacation blends high-quality dental care with a restorative holiday. Instead of choosing expensive procedures at home, patients travel to a destination that offers both exceptional dentistry and a relaxed, culturally rich escape. Cuenca, Ecuador’s elegant colonial city and a UNESCO World Heritage site, is uniquely suited to this purpose: its manageable pace, reliable medical infrastructure, and stunning surroundings make it a practical and pleasant place to recover between appointments.

Cuenca as the perfect recovery and tourism backdrop
Picking a clinic is about more than dentistry—your recovery period should be enjoyable. Cuenca’s mild climate (it sits at around 2,560 meters or 8,400 feet), compact historic center, and welcoming culture make it easy to relax. Spend your downtime exploring cobblestone streets, visiting the Parque Calderón, or taking gentle day trips to Cajas National Park for easy hikes and dramatic lakes. Cuenca’s slower pace fits well with post-op rest and light sightseeing.
Local attractions to enjoy between appointments
- Historic Old Town and El Sagrario Cathedral — enjoy architecture and cafés within walking distance of many clinics.
- Turi viewpoint and artisan markets — perfect for low-impact sightseeing and shopping.
- Day trips to Cajas National Park — fresh air and nature that support recovery.
- Thermal springs and rural hamlets — restful options for light activity days.
Practical travel and logistics tips for a dental vacation with Smilehealth Ecuador
Planning your trip carefully ensures a smooth experience. Smilehealth Ecuador provides a dedicated coordinator to help with scheduling and logistics, but here are practical tips to prepare:
- Start with a virtual consult. Send photos and recent dental records so Smilehealth can pre-assess and create a preliminary treatment plan and timeline.
- Confirm your visa and entry requirements. Most visitors can enter Ecuador visa-free for up to 90 days, but check your country’s rules before travel.
- Book your arrival in Cuenca. Cuenca’s Mariscal Lamar Airport (CUE) has flights from major Ecuadorian cities; the clinic can assist with airport transfers from Cuenca or nearby cities like Guayaquil.
- Plan for acclimatization. Cuenca’s elevation may require a day or two to adjust; Smilehealth recommends taking it easy on arrival if you’re coming from lower altitudes.
- Arrange comfortable accommodation near the clinic. Smilehealth can recommend hotels, guesthouses, and long-stay apartments tailored to post-op needs.
Treatment timelines and recovery expectations
Understanding timeframes helps you arrange travel and vacation activities without surprises. For many cosmetic cases like crowns and veneers, patients typically need one to two visits over 7–14 days. Implant treatments vary: immediate implants may allow for same-day temporary teeth, while staged implants require healing time of several months before final crowns. Smilehealth provides clear timelines and often offers telehealth follow-up so you don’t have to rush back to Cuenca unless necessary.
